RUHPOLDING, Germany (February 29,2012) - The 2012 IBU World Championships open tomorrow in Ruhpolding, Germany with the 2x6+2x7.5 km Mixed Relay featuring a team of two women & two men.  Sara Studebaker (Boise, ID), Susan Dunklee (Barton, VT), Tim Burke (Paul Smiths, NY) and Lowell Bailey (Lake Placid, NY) will start for Team USA.

 

“The team arrived here in Ruhpolding on Monday after our final preparation in Ridaun, Italy. We think that we have done everything we can now, and everybody is looking forward to the start of the races ,” said US Biathlon Head Coach Per Nilsson. “The team has had an up-going trend in January and February, which we wanted due to the late date for the World Championships, so we know that we have a good capacity. The key is to continue to stay with the routine that every athlete has. They should just do the normal work and focus on things that they can impact. Then we will have some good results over the next 10 days.”

 

“The team really feels at home here in Ruhpolding. We’ve had several summer camps here, so it feels natural for them to be here,” said Bernd Eisenbichler, US Biathlon High Performance Director. “Everyone has done their work - the athletes, coaches, wax technicians, the physiotherapists - and now it’s time to go ahead and execute what we’ve been working on over the last year.”

 

The World Championships continue through March 11th. Ruhpolding has a 34 year history of hosting of World Cup and World Championship event.  Ticket sales have reached 30,000 per day and the TV audience is expected to exceed 25 million viewers per competition.

2012 U.S. Biathlon IBU World Championship Team

 

Men 

Lowell Bailey (Lake Placid, NY) - World Cup Ranking: 13th - two 5th place finishes

Tim Burke (Paul Smiths, NY) - World Cup Ranking: 22nd - 6th & 8th place finishes

Russell Currier (Stockholm, ME) - World Cup Ranking: 47th - two 6th place finishes 

Jay Hakkinen (Kasilof, AK) - World Cup Ranking: 33rd - 9th & 14th place finishes

Leif Nordgren (Marine, MN) - World Cup Ranking: 94th - 33rd & 48th place finishes

 

Women 

Lanny Barnes (Durango, CO) - 2nd & 4th place finishes in IBU Cup 7, Canmore

Annelies Cook (Saranac Lake, NY) - World Cup Ranking: 76th - 33rd & 39th place finishes

Susan Dunklee (Barton, VT) - World Cup Ranking: 48th - 17th & 27th place finishes

Sara Studebaker (Boise, ID) - World Cup Ranking: 55th - 15th & 23rd place finishes
